Analysis

Georgia recorded 26,031 for age population, age 13, female, interpolated in 2025.

That represents a change of down 1.4% on the previous year and up 28.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, age population, age 13, female, interpolated in Georgia peaked at 51,760 in 1976 and was at its lowest, 20,105, in 2017.

Georgia ranks 135th of 215 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 66 years of available data.
